Web{"content":{"product":{"title":"Je bekeek","product":{"productDetails":{"productId":"9200000006683563","productTitle":{"title":"Experiments … Web2 feb. 2024 · Scientific evidence shows that love, attention, and affection in the first years of life have a direct and measurable impact on a child's physical, mental, and emotional growth. Love and touch also help your baby's brain develop. How do you show your love? Hug, touch, smile, encourage, speak to, listen to, and play with your little one often.

Scientists have shown they can identify Parkinson’s disease using a biological marker even before physical symptoms arise, such as tremors, balance issues or loss of smell. The test, known by the acronym αSyn-SAA, was found to have robust sensitivity in detecting synuclein pathology — a buildup of abnormal ...
